What they do

A Calibration Technician is responsible for the routine inspection, testing, maintenance and repair of instruments and manufacturing equipment. The purpose of the calibration technician role is to ensure the accuracy of the measurements taken using this equipment.

Essential Functions:
Calibration encompassing the following core disciplines: Temperature, Pressure, Flow (liquid and air), Electronics, Time, Torque, Force and Dimensional. Additional training will be provided post-hire as needed. Reviewing equipment lists, procedures, and specifications, and ensuring proper standards are selected for work assigned. Individual must ensure all company-issued tools and property are in proper working order and in calibration. Perform clerical work associated with calibration activities including certificates of calibration. Must provide the original data worksheet for final inspection by Quality. Perform quality inspection of calibrated equipment as approved by the Quality Manager. All certificates for equipment calibrated on-site and in house shall be completed in a timely manner (within 48 hours of job completion.) Keep in good order all tools and equipment, practice good housekeeping Maintain a safety and customer service mindset at all times Consistently maintain good work attendance and productive work ethic.
